WebA garden tool is one of those many types of tools that are used for gardening, horticulture and agriculture. Garden tools can largely be divided into short and long-handled hand tools and garden power tools. Some common hand tools include spade, garden hoe, pitchfork, garden fork, garden rake and plough. Indoor Watering Can When it comes to watering cans, one size does not fit all. A watering can that works great outdoors may be cumbersome for your indoor needs. For optimal efficiency, look for one that is small, (about a half-gallon capacity) and lightweight and has a long, thin neck. farming by the moonWeb4. Get qualified.
